Counseling Corner
Teach your child to set goals for themselves.  Goals should be SMART
S = Specific
M = Measurable
A = Attainable
R = Relevant, Rigorous, Realistic, and Results Focused
T = Timely and Trackable

A goal has to be realistic with a stretch, requiring effort and focus to achieve it. That's why goals need timeframes and measurable action steps along the way so that we can keep track of progress and make adjustments as necessary.
For example: In the next marking period, I will get at least a C on all my math tests, and at least a B on most of my quizzes and homework assignments.
